Why were the high priests so powerful in Inca society

Social Studies
2 answers:
dimulka [17.4K]3 years ago
8 0

Explanation:

High Priest - The high priest, called the "Willaq Umu", was also a very powerful man. He was probably second in power to the Sapa Inca due to the importance of religion in the Inca Empire.

What was significant in having the approval of nine states, rather than all 13, to bring the Constitution into being?
KengaRu [80]

Answer:

A unanimous vote of the states was necessary to change the Articles of Confederation.

Explanation:

Ratification is the official way to confirm something, usually by vote. It is the formal validation of a proposed law.

The ratification process started when the Congress turned the Constitution over to the state legislatures for consideration through specially elected state conventions of the people.

As dictated by Article VII, the document would not become binding until it was ratified by nine of the 13 states.
